Abstract
Epidemiologic and demographic characteristics of 285 patients operated for perforated duodenal ulcer in 1972-1991 are discussed. A decrease in the number of patients undergoing surgery for the uncomplicated duodenal ulcer is being noted. However, surgery rate in patients with perforated duodenal ulcer remains constant. Only 14% of patients undergoing surgery for perforated duodenal ulcer is under 60. Most frequently such operations are performed in young and middle aged male patients. The obtained results suggest that there is a strong correlation between perforated duodenal ulcer and long duration of the disease, family ulcer history, and smoking.
